Why implement your industrial space in St. Louis?  

St. Louis boasts a thriving market for industrial space for lease, catering to a diverse range of businesses and industries. The city offers a wide selection of options, including warehouses, manufacturing facilities, distribution centers, and logistics hubs.

With its central location in the Midwest, St. Louis provides excellent connectivity to major transportation routes, making it an ideal hub for logistics and distribution operations. The city's robust infrastructure, skilled workforce, and favorable business environment further contribute to its appeal for industrial leasing. Whether businesses require expansive square footage, specialized facilities, or proximity to key markets, St. Louis offers a range of industrial spaces for lease to accommodate various operational needs.

How much does it cost to rent an industrial space in St. Louis?

The cost of renting an industrial space in St. Louis can vary depending on factors such as location, size, amenities, and specific requirements. The average rental rates for industrial space in St. Louis range from approximately $4 to $9 per square foot per year.

What types of industrial space are available in St. Louis?

St. Louis offers a diverse range of industrial spaces to meet the varied needs of businesses. The city features warehouse spaces, manufacturing facilities, distribution centers, and flex spaces. Warehouse spaces are ideal for storage and logistics operations, offering ample square footage and high ceilings. Manufacturing facilities in St. Louis are equipped with the necessary infrastructure to support production activities, including heavy-duty flooring and advanced utilities. Distribution centers benefit from the city's strategic location and transportation links, facilitating efficient supply chain operations. Flex spaces provide versatility, allowing businesses to customize the space for office, storage, or light manufacturing purposes. Each type of industrial space in St. Louis is designed to support the growth and efficiency of businesses across various industries.


What is the typical size range of industrial spaces for lease in St. Louis?

Industrial spaces for lease in St. Louis vary widely in size, accommodating both small businesses and large enterprises. The typical size range can start from smaller spaces of a few thousand square feet, ideal for startups or businesses with limited storage needs. Medium-sized spaces, ranging from 10,000 to 50,000 square feet, are suitable for companies requiring more substantial storage or production areas. For larger operations, St. Louis offers expansive industrial spaces exceeding 100,000 square feet, perfect for large-scale manufacturing or distribution centers. This wide range of sizes ensures that businesses of all scales can find a suitable industrial space to meet their operational requirements in St. Louis.


Popular neighborhoods in St. Louis?

St. Louis offers several popular neighborhoods for leasing industrial space, each with its own advantages and characteristics. Some of the popular neighborhoods in St. Louis for industrial leasing include:

  • Downtown St. Louis: The downtown area provides convenient access to major highways and transportation networks, making it a sought-after location for industrial operations. It offers proximity to the central business district and has a mix of warehouses and industrial buildings suitable for various industries.
  • Soulard: Located just south of downtown, Soulard is a historic neighborhood with a mix of residential and industrial spaces. It offers easy access to major highways and is known for its charm and character, making it an attractive option for businesses seeking industrial space with a unique atmosphere.
  • North Riverfront: Situated along the Mississippi River, the North Riverfront neighborhood is known for its industrial infrastructure. It provides easy access to river transportation and has a range of industrial spaces, including warehouses and manufacturing facilities.
  • St. Louis Hills: Located in southwest St. Louis, St. Louis Hills offers a mix of residential and industrial areas. It has a variety of industrial properties available for lease, particularly for businesses looking for light industrial operations.
  • The Hill: The Hill is a vibrant neighborhood known for its Italian-American heritage and rich culture. It offers a mix of industrial spaces suitable for different purposes, such as small manufacturing, distribution, or specialty operations.


Getting to and from St. Louis?

St. Louis, located in the Midwestern United States, can be easily accessed by several transportation options.

  • By Air: The city is served by the Lambert-St. Louis International Airport (STL), which is located approximately 13 miles from downtown St. Louis. The airport is well-connected to several domestic and international destinations and offers ground transportation options such as rental cars, taxis, ride-sharing services, and public transportation.
  • By Car: St. Louis is located at the intersection of several major highways, including Interstate 70, Interstate 44, and Interstate 55. The city is also connected to several major cities in the Midwest by a network of interstate highways.
  • By Train: Amtrak offers train service to St. Louis via its Gateway Station, which is located in downtown St. Louis. The station is served by several routes, including the Missouri River Runner, which connects St. Louis to Kansas City, and the Texas Eagle, which connects St. Louis to Chicago and San Antonio.
  • By Bus: Several bus companies offer service to St. Louis, including Greyhound and Megabus. The city is also served by a local public transportation system, Metro Transit, which offers bus and light rail service throughout the region.
